The Dark Night of the Soul, though not at all pleasant to move through, is such a beautiful blessing of transformation that happens as we move along the Path to Freedom and Awakening. This is the space where the old is dying and the new is emerging, only the old hasn't quite dissolved yet, and the new hasn't quite emerged yet, leaving us in a space of confusion and unease. I invite you to join me as we explore what the Dark Night is and how we can navigate through it, being as understanding, gentle, and kind to ourselves as we possibly can be.

And what happens in that chrysalis,

What happens in doing that metamorphosis is that the caterpillar ceases to exist.

So it moves into the chrysalis and at some point new cells actually begin to emerge within the caterpillar.

Now initially the immune system of the caterpillar kills these cells off because they're perceived as threats.

They are foreign to the caterpillar.

So the caterpillar's immune system kills them off.

But these new cells,

They begin to proliferate to the point where the caterpillar's immune system is overrun.

And in that overrunning,

The caterpillar ceases to exist.

It dissolves,

It liquefies and the butterfly begins to emerge.

So one creature is crawling into the cocoon.

A completely different creature is flying out of it,

Emerging out of it.

And this is a beautiful metaphor to the dark night of the soul.

There's a beautiful statement that brings some comfort and that brings some guidance as to how to navigate through these dark nights of the soul.

I believe it was coined by Dr.

Howard Thurman where he said that we navigate by the light we once knew.

We navigate by the light we once knew.

And what this means is that even though we perhaps do not feel our connection with Spirit,

Even though we perhaps no longer believe that we are worth squat,

That life is worth living at all,

We lean into what we used to know,

What we used to trust before someone turned off the light.

So we get to navigate by the compass and by the map that we used to navigate with.

Even though we perhaps do not feel it,

We're not feeling it,

But we still can lean into the memory of how we used to navigate,

In which direction we were moving.

So we just keep on moving.
